Rejected petition Parliament shall only invoke Article 50 to leave the EU after a general election

When/if we invoke Article 50 and trigger the 2-year deadline to leave the EU, we absolutely need a strong government with a clear mandate from the people. With a manifesto based on what the government will actually be doing next.

We can't petition for a general election but we can ask this much.

More details

The Scottish referendum had a 670-page plan. This one had none.

Now that the preference of the people is known, we need a say in what actually happens next, and how. This could be the biggest single change in our country for hundreds of years and the people have never been asked how it should be done, and what outcome we should be negotiating for.

We absolutely need to elect the next government based on their manifesto for handling the Leave result. It cannot be left to just 330 MPs to decide.
